Just to let you know. Last year we went up the Saturday after Thanksgiving, which is the day you are thinking of adding. MK was packed around 5 pm but the line for Stitch was only about 15 min wait (we had been waiting a yr for this to open so we were there) but everything else was about 45-60mins. We decided to head to the hotel for dinner. At about 9pm it rained for about 30 mins so we decided to walk to MK, it had emptied out and they were going to be open til midnight. I say if you decided to go to MK don't be after to go back later, remember most people are leaving Sunday to return home and won't be staying out late. We loved it!

I'd suggest you get the flight info first. Holidays can really impact airfares.

In our case, it was cheaper to add a day on the end. Flying home on Coloumbus Day would have cost us $100 more per person. (five of us) When the extra night at POR was only about $135, PLUS it got us another day's worth of free dining each, it was a no-brainer to come home a day later instead.
